Fig. 1. Intranodal lymphangiography. (A) Ultrasound-guided lymph node puncture. A 23-gauge Cathelin needle (white arrow) and lymph node (white arrowheads) are seen. (B) If puncture is successful, the lymph node is visualized in granular form by the injected Lipiodol (black arrow), and lymphatic vessels extending from the lymph node are immediately visualized. (C) Lipiodol lymphangiography of the pelvis.
